http://ac.jobdu.com/problem.php?pid=1041
// 坑爹的一道题,不能用qsort( )或sort( )排序函数,必须自己写一个排序。。。
#include<stdio.h>
int main(){
int i,j,t,n,a[1005];
while(scanf("%d",&n)!=EOF){
for(i=0;i<n;i++) scanf("%d",&a[i]);
for(i=0;i<n;i++){
for(j=i+1;j<n;j++){
if(a[j]<a[i]){
t=a[i];
a[i]=a[j];
a[j]=t;
}
}
}
for(i=0;i<n;i++){
while(a[i+1]==a[i]) i++;
if(a[i]==a[0]) printf("%d",a[i]);
else printf(" %d",a[i]);
}
printf("\n");
}
return 0;
}